在云计算领域中,System.Diagnostics.Process.Start是一个常用的方法,用于启动一个新的进程。然而,有时候它的行为可能会让人感到困惑。
这种情况可能是由于以下原因导致的:
- 权限问题:如果当前进程没有足够的权限来启动新进程,那么System.Diagnostics.Process.Start方法可能会失败。
- 路径问题:如果指定的文件路径不正确,那么System.Diagnostics.Process.Start方法可能会失败。
- 文件关联问题:如果指定的文件没有与任何应用程序关联,那么System.Diagnostics.Process.Start方法可能会失败。
- 操作系统问题:在某些操作系统中,System.Diagnostics.Process.Start方法可能会表现出不同的行为。
为了解决这些问题,可以尝试以下方法:
- 确保当前进程具有足够的权限来启动新进程。
- 确保指定的文件路径正确。
- 确保指定的文件与应用程序关联。
- 在不同的操作系统中测试System.Diagnostics.Process.Start方法,以确保其表现出一致的行为。
推荐的腾讯云相关产品:
- 腾讯云服务器(CVM):提供可靠、稳定、安全、高性能的计算服务,适用于各种应用场景。
- 腾讯云容器产品:提供容器相关的解决方案,包括腾讯云容器服务(TKE)和腾讯云容器实例(TCI)。
- 腾讯云云函数:提供无服务器计算服务,可以帮助用户快速开发、部署和管理应用程序。
- 腾讯云虚拟私有云(VPC):提供稳定、可靠、安全、灵活的专属网络服务,支持用户自定义网络配置。
产品介绍链接地址:
- 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云容器产品:https://cloud.tencent.com/product/tke
- 腾讯云云函数:https://cloud.tencent.com/product/scf
- 腾讯云虚拟私有云(VPC):https://cloud.tencent.com/product/vpc